Public Art in Downtown Miami Walking Tour with T. Wheeler Castillo

02/27/2021 @ 10:00 am 11:30 am

Museum Members: $10, Non-Members: $20

Meet in front of HistoryMiami Museum, 101 West Flagler Street, Miami, Florida 33130

Join HistoryMiami Museum tour guide T. Wheeler Castillo on a fascinating tour of Downtown Miami’s public art scene. Explore how public art initiatives have transformed Miami’s urban landscape, while bringing the history and culture of the area to life.

Tour includes visit to Miami-Dade Public Library – Main Library and ride on Metromover.

About T. Wheeler Castillo

Thom Wheeler Castillo lives and works in Miami, FL; Graduated from PNCA, Intermedia. Wheeler Castillo is interested in the landscape and ecosystems, past (art history) and present (Environmental Studies); he works from an interdisciplinary approach in his relentless pursuit of poetry, art history, earth science and anthropology.
